I just upgraded the base-devel package in Manjaro. Now after rebooting it showed me error
Failed to start Authorization Manager.
I changed my grub configuration and login to my account using terminal.
But whenever I run the command to update or upgrade anything to fix it. It again throws an error.
e.g. pacman -Syu
pacman: /usr/lib/libc.so.6: version ‘GLIBC_2.33’ not found (required by pacman)
pacman: /usr/lib/libc.so.6: version ‘GLIBC_2.33’ not found (required by /usr/lib/libalpm.so.12)
As you can see in this case, neither sudo neither Pacman is working as both are dependent on this GLIBC_2.33. To fix or update this package I again need Pacman to work.
I am a fresh user of Manjaro. I don’t know exactly how to do this. Can you please explain me how to do this ?
All I know is my root partition is installed on my sda9 partition
do not need chroot.
in manjaro live mount your system partitions and now enter this commands :
sudo pacman -S arch-install-scripts
pacstrap -i /mnt glibc lib32-glibc
Pacman not broken in live manjaro
he most install arch-install-scripts with pacman in live manjaro after use pacstrap to install glibc and lib32-glibc.
